From the Swim to Transition 1 is acceptable. However (certainly under British Triathlon Association rules), from that point on shirts are mandatory, and nothing more than torsos are allowed to be exposed in transition areas. All the running events I have entered have mandated shirts, as well. It’s a rule for competing, so it is reasonable to apply it as a discipline to training as well. And a proper workout shirt should be as cool (and safer sun-wise) than bare skin.

National high school rules(track) forbid the removal of any part of the uniform while in the competition area.

However, don’t forget the whole ruckus involves a training run, not at a meet.

Where I coach, the kids often run shirtless(cost, not everyone can afford technical fiber shirts) and even the girls often run in sports bras. At meets, the kids often change in the stands(remove or put on undershirts) with no complaints.
